Kaduna gov’s Chief of Staff denies owing hotel bills

Advertisement

The chief of staff to the governor of Kaduna State, Mohammed Sani Kila, has refuted a claim that hotel management confronted him for failing to pay outstanding bills.

The said report alleged that he had slept in a hotel for weeks without paying bills.

In a statement signed by Ibrahim Aliyu Giwa, who works in the office of the chief of staff to the Kaduna State governor, he denied the allegation, branding the story false and malicious.

According to the statement, “the story was intended to impugn and smear the character, integrity, and reputation of the Chief of Staff.”

It stated: “The Chief of Staff resides in his house in Kaduna, [while] the hotel was secured for temporary accommodation of the newly appointed members of staff before the processing of the payment of their accommodation allowances.

“[This] is a statutory right of the first 28 days for [newly-appointed] public servants, and the hotel management is familiar with government procedures for processing payment and patiently pursuing their claims.”

The statement conveyed Kila’s resolve to take legal measures against the hotel and management.
